Gokarna Forest Resort Kathmandu, a 5-star retreat, sits within a 190 hectare protected forest, offering serene accommodations and a world-class golf course. The hotel includes a luxurious spa, outdoor swimming pool, and multiple dining options featuring local and international cuisine.
Rooms & Amenities
Gokarna Forest Resort Kathmandu features elegantly furnished rooms boasting views of either the golf course or lush surroundings. Each accommodation includes a mini-bar, tea/coffee-making facilities, luxury bath amenities, and air conditioning, ensuring guests have a comfortable and relaxing stay.
Dining Options
The hotel offers three dining options, including Hunter's Lodge, which specializes in local and international dishes. Guests can enjoy buffet-style dinner service with a variety of flavors, complemented by fresh ingredients and traditional techniques.
Leisure & Wellness
For leisure, Gokarna Forest Resort has a golf course regarded as one of South Asia's finest, offering 18 holes set in scenic forest landscapes. The luxury spa provides Ayurvedic treatments and wellness therapies, along with a gym and yoga sessions.
Business & Local Area
Gokarna Forest Resort Kathmandu is a suitable venue for corporate events and retreats, featuring modern conference rooms and banquet facilities. Additionally, the location provides access to nearby cultural sites such as Boudhanath Stupa, just 3.5 km away.

Gokarna Forest Resort offers a delightful array of dining options that celebrate both local and international flavors. Guests can indulge in a variety of culinary experiences, from traditional Nepalese dishes to vibrant Asian and international fare, all set against the backdrop of the serene forest environment.
Durbar Restaurant
Asian, International
Ambiance
Traditional setting that reflects Nepalese heritage, enhancing the dining experience with an inviting warmth.
Key Offerings
Enjoy a diverse menu featuring halal, vegan, gluten-free, and dairy-free options. Perfect for breakfast, brunch, lunch, dinner, along with high tea and cocktail hour.
Reservation
No
Open for breakfast, brunch, lunch, dinner, high tea, and cocktail hour.
8848 Mr Bar and Patio
Nepalese, International
Ambiance
Charming patio with a laid-back atmosphere, suitable for casual meals and gathering with friends or family.
Key Offerings
Savor breakfast with a delightful pastry section and an abundance of fresh fruit. Available for high tea and meals throughout the day.
Reservation
No
Breakfast, lunch, dinner, and high tea; open daily from 07:00 - 21:00.
